Tag Archives: Mechanically Stabilized Earth Foundation Walls

Mechanically stabilized earth walls

Advantages in economics, ease of construction, and an abundance of proprietary wall systems have increased the popularity of mechanically stabilized earth (MSE) walls. The contract delivery methods vary, often confusing the roles and responsibilities of various project team members.

+ Read More